e8c80767a61512b95a98159ac00341bae7e765e4,contrib/go/src/python/pants/contrib/go/tasks/go_protobuf_gen.py,GoProtobufGen,_get_go_namespace,#Any#Any#,102

Before Change


    with open(source) as fh:
      namespace = cls._NAMESPACE_PARSER.search(fh.read())
      if not namespace:
        raise TaskError("File {} must contain "option go_package"".format(source))
      return namespace.group(1)

After Change


      data = fh.read()
    namespace = cls._NAMESPACE_PARSER.search(data)
    if not namespace:
      namespace = cls._PACKAGE_PARSER.search(data)
    return namespace.group(1)
Italian Trulli
In pattern: SUPERPATTERN

Frequency: 3

Non-data size: 2

Instances


Project Name: pantsbuild/pants
Commit Name: e8c80767a61512b95a98159ac00341bae7e765e4
Time: 2018-06-01
Author: traviscrawford@gmail.com
File Name: contrib/go/src/python/pants/contrib/go/tasks/go_protobuf_gen.py
Class Name: GoProtobufGen
Method Name: _get_go_namespace


Project Name: okfn-brasil/serenata-de-amor
Commit Name: cef99445ab551931fed507518b85034b97c946ee
Time: 2016-11-09
Author: cuducos@gmail.com
File Name: src/search_suspect_places.py
Class Name:
Method Name: search_suspicious_around_company


Project Name: Qiskit/qiskit-aqua
Commit Name: 6e3fb1d3406a255fc602a7cc5912141a0aab2e91
Time: 2019-02-19
Author: manoel@us.ibm.com
File Name: qiskit_aqua_ui/run/_threadsafeoutputview.py
Class Name: ThreadSafeOutputView
Method Name: _write_text